Oracle Linux: Server Boot Fails with "dracut-initqueue[XXXX]: Warning: /dev/disk/by-uuid/XXXX-XXXX-XXXX-XXXX does not exist" (Doc ID 3014593.1)

Last updated on JANUARY 14, 2025

Applies to:

Linux OS - Version Oracle Linux 7.9 with Unbreakable Enterprise Kernel [5.4.17] and later
Linux x86-64

Symptoms

The kernel of an Oracle Linux 7 OL7 UEK6 system has been updated from version 5.4.17-2136.326.6.1.el7uek.x86_64 to 5.4.17-2136.329.3.1.el7uek.x86_64

When booting the newer kernel, the system fails to boot - a message, such as the following, is displayed to the system console:

 

Changes

 An Oracle Linux 7 system was recently updated to kernel version 5.4.17-2136.329.3.1.el7uek.x86_64
